Books, field trips, movies broaden language classes MVS- Adele Biles MF- Ernest Kalm Mrs. Henrietta Marquez Mrs. Helen Middleton Field trips and French films served as methods towards more interesting classes and the expansion of curriculum. Due to donations from the Parent-Teachers- Association, the department was able to rent French films which helped to increase the awareness and understanding of the French culture. Field trips were planned throughout the entire year. The neccessity for new books was fulfilled. The Spanish classes received new Level l books. Mrs. Adele Biles was the new Language department head. Reporters attend special press conclave Dr. Marcus Foster, superintendent, called a special press conference September 15 to discuss the year's activity. Attending from Skyline were Karen Clarkson, reporter, Mrs. Pege Rankin, journalism teacher, Tim Clancy, Oracle editor and Wayne Batavia, student body president. All six schools were represented. Management, family care, and home safety were emphasized in the homemaking department with sewing and cooking a smaller role in the curriculum. Mrs. Kazuye Yoshimura, department head, broadened the scope of the department by starting classes in stitchery and needle arts. To accomodate students unable to include homemaking in their daily schedules, weekly classes were held after school. RIGHT: Mrs. Charlotte Rich and students Diane Brown, Kim Stinnett.
